#983f33 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#983f33 is composed of 59.6% red, 24.7%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.6% magenta, 66.4%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 7.1 degrees, a saturation of 49.8% and a lightness of 39.8%. #983f33 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7e66 with #310000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#983f33

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050202 is the darkest color, while #fcf6f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#983f33

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696362 is the less saturated color, while #c71b04 is the most saturated one.
